We are looking for a Production Planner/Master Scheduler. This position will be based in Grand Prairie, TX.
The Production Planner/Master Scheduler will play a key role in driving schedule optimization for several product lines, including the scheduling of detailed tasks for 6 assembly supervisors and more than 150 hourly employees. The scheduler plays a critical role in collaborating with business leadership, application engineering teams, business development teams, sales, customers, project managers, contract administrators, and factory leadership.
You will make an impact by:
• Coordinate with application engineering teams (AE) and project management teams (PM) on project schedules to drive timely scheduling and optimization of engineering and factory output
• Monitor capacity utilization and ensure that production lines are loaded to maximize output while aligning with business priorities
• Monitor and report any delays regarding Engineering tasks scheduling to assure timely releases of drawing packages to customers and bills of materials to factory
• Conduct product specific production and load meetings to assure alignment between business unit and factory
• Provide regular reporting to the organization on loading status and Delivery Reliability performance
• Coordinate with PM's and project engineers on change order management as it relates to project timelines and needs
• Evaluate and assign projects based on the complexity and product mix
• Keep all SAP dates and related production schedules updated and communicate changes through proper channels.
• Improve scheduling methodology and represent product in implementation of new scheduling and production management software
• Develop and report appropriate KPIs including Delivery Reliability and Loading Status
You'll win us over by having the following qualifications:
Basic Qualifications
• Bachelor's degree in Engineering, Materials Management, Business Administration or related discipline.
• 2+ years' experience as a Production Scheduler, Master Scheduler, Project Engineer, Buyer/Planner or Production Planner in a Manufacturing environment.
• Strong skills in MS Office (Excel and/or Access) and strong math skills/background
Preferred Qualifications
• Knowledge of Low Voltage electrical distribution equipment
• Prior experience with complex engineering, production, or service environments
• SAP experience preferred
